Area contextNeighborhood Overview – Cordia School (Hazard, KY)
Cordia School is situated in a semi-rural setting on Lotts Creek Road, approximately 8 miles northeast of downtown Hazard, Kentucky. Access to the school is primarily via Lotts Creek Road, which connects to KY-15, a main artery for the region. The closest major airport is Blue Grass Airport (LEX) in Lexington, about a 2.5-hour drive. Traveling to Cordia School involves navigating winding country roads, so allow ample time, especially during peak travel periods or inclement weather. Parking at the school is generally straightforward, with designated areas for visitors, but can become crowded during larger events. Rideshare services may have limited availability in this more remote area, making personal vehicle or pre-arranged transportation the most reliable options. Plan your arrival to account for the scenic, yet potentially slower, rural routes.
Lodging contextWhere to Stay Near Cordia School
Lodging options closest to Cordia School are concentrated in downtown Hazard, which is about a 15-20 minute drive away. These hotels cater to visitors attending events at the school or in the wider Perry County area. While there aren't many hotels within immediate walking distance, the drive to Hazard offers a selection of familiar chains and local motels. For teams and families, booking accommodations in Hazard is typically the most practical choice, providing easier access to dining and essential services. Demand for hotels can increase during major school sporting events or tournaments, so booking well in advance is highly recommended. Weather & Seasons at Cordia School
- Winter: Winter in this part of Kentucky typically brings cold temperatures, with averages often in the 30s Fahrenheit. Expect chilly conditions, necessitating warm layers, hats, and gloves for anyone spending time outdoors. Outdoor events might face delays or cancellations due to snow or icy roads. Indoor facilities become more appealing during this season for both games and downtime.
- Spring & early summer: Spring and early summer offer milder, pleasant weather, with temperatures gradually warming into the 60s and 70s. This is an ideal time for outdoor sports, though occasional rain showers are common, particularly in the spring. Lightweight layers are recommended, and packing a light rain jacket is wise. Days become longer, allowing for extended activity periods.
- Mid-summer: Mid-summer (July-August) brings the heat and humidity, with temperatures frequently reaching the 80s and 90s Fahrenheit. Staying hydrated is paramount. Sunscreen, hats, and seeking shade during breaks are essential for comfort and safety during outdoor events. Evening games might offer some relief from the peak daytime heat.
- Fall season: Fall provides a welcome respite from summer heat, with crisp, cool air and average temperatures often in the 50s and 60s. This season is generally excellent for outdoor sports. Pack layers, as mornings can be cool, warming up significantly by midday. The vibrant autumn foliage adds a scenic backdrop to any outdoor activities.
- Rain & snow: Rain is possible year-round, though more frequent in spring and fall. Snowfall is typical in winter months, potentially disrupting travel and outdoor events. Always check local weather advisories and road conditions before traveling to Cordia School, especially during winter or periods of heavy rain. Be prepared for slick conditions if precipitation occurs.
